CVE-2018-9143
On Samsung mobile devices with M(6.0) and N(7.x) software, a heap overflow in the sensorhub binder service leads to code execution in a privileged process, aka SVE-2017-10991.

CVE-2018-10751
A malformed OMACP WAP push message can cause memory corruption on a Samsung S7 Edge device when processing the String Extension portion of the WbXml payload. This is due to an integer overflow in memory allocation for this string. The Samsung ID is SVE-2018-11463.

CVE-2018-9142
On Samsung mobile devices with N(7.x) software, attackers can install an arbitrary APK in the Secure Folder SD Card area because of faulty validation of a package signature and package name, aka SVE-2017-10932.

CVE-2018-9139
On Samsung mobile devices with N(7.x) software, a buffer overflow in the vision service allows code execution in a privileged process via a large frame size, aka SVE-2017-11165.

CVE-2018-9141
On Samsung mobile devices with L(5.x), M(6.0), and N(7.x) software, Gallery allows remote malicious users to execute arbitrary code via a BMP file with a crafted resolution, aka SVE-2017-11105.
